Code Ann. § 12-60-1320","heading":"Exhaustion of prehearing remedies; request for hearing; time limitation.","body":"Upon exhaustion of his prehearing remedy, a person may seek relief from the department's determination by requesting a contested case hearing before the Administrative Law Court. This request must be made within thirty days after the date the department's determination was sent by first class mail or delivered to the person. Requests for a hearing before the Administrative Law Court must be made in accordance with its rules.","path":["Title 12 - TAXATION","CHAPTER 60 South Carolina Revenue Procedures Act","ARTICLE 5 State Revenue Appeals Procedure","Subarticle 9 Applications for Licenses and Suspensions and Revocations of Licenses"],"source_url":"https://www.scstatehouse.gov/code/t12c060.php","current_through":"2025 Session of the General Assembly","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-02T06:37:29Z","sha256":"10ffd6e818d1f849df8391075d71a118c4f55d6b83458e442eb741c87615a2da","source_id":"us-sc","stale":false,"prev":"us-sc/s.c.-code-ann.-12-60-1310","next":"us-sc/s.c.-code-ann.-12-60-1330"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
